We are seeking a skilled and motivated Engineer to join our growing team within a well-established provider of powered access solutions based in Leeds. The business is known for delivering reliable, high-quality equipment and exceptional service to customers across a wide range of sectors, from construction and maintenance to industrial and commercial environments. With a strong reputation for safety, innovation, and customer support, the company offers a dynamic and professional setting where engineers can thrive.

This role is ideal for someone with a solid mechanical or electrical engineering background who is looking to develop their expertise within the access equipment sector. While previous experience working with powered access machinery would be highly advantageous, our client is equally interested in engineers from other industries who can offer transferable skills and a proactive, problem-solving mindset.

Overview
  • Carry out servicing, maintenance, and repairs on a range of powered access equipment.
  • Split role between workshop-based tasks and mobile engineering responsibilities.
  • Diagnose faults and identify effective repair solutions to minimise equipment downtime.
  • Conduct thorough inspections to ensure all machines meet safety and compliance standards.
  • Provide on-site support to customers, offering a high level of technical expertise and service.
  • Prepare equipment for hire, ensuring all machinery is fully operational and presented to a high standard.
  • Complete all relevant documentation accurately, including service records and inspection reports.
  • Work collaboratively with the wider engineering and operations team to maintain efficient workflow.
  • Support breakdown callouts when required, maintaining a professional and customer-focused approach.
Requirements
  • Previous experience working with powered access equipment is highly desirable, but not essential.
  • Commutable distance of Leeds.
  • Strong mechanical and/or electrical engineering skills gained from any relevant industry.
  • Ability to diagnose faults and carry out effective repairs independently.
  • Confidence working both in a workshop environment and on customer sites.
  • Understanding of LOLER, PUWER, and general safety standards is an advantage.
  • A qualification in engineering, plant, mechanical, electrical or similar (NVQ, City & Guilds, or equivalent) is preferred.
  • Full UK driving licence is essential due to the mobile nature of the role.
  • Strong problem-solving skills and a proactive approach to technical challenges.
  • Good communication skills and the ability to deliver excellent customer service.
  • Reliable, self-motivated, and able to work effectively as part of a team.
Salary & Benefits

£30,000-£40,000 (Dependant on experience). Potential for higher basic if carry the CAP qualification. 40-hour week. Company vehicle. Fuel card. 28 days holiday inc bank. Pension. Ongoing training and progression within the role.
